site stats

Difference between knn and weighted knn

WebJan 26, 2008 · Unlike traditional distance-weighted KNN which assigns different weights to the nearest neighbors according to the distance to the unclassified sample, difference … WebJul 24, 2024 · 2.3 Weighted K-Nearest Neighbor. To estimate locations with fingerprinting, some popular methods are used including deterministic [8,9,10, 14], probabilistic , and proximity . In deterministic methods, a combination of RSS-based fingerprinting and kNN is needed to achieve a higher positioning accuracy . The main drawback of this method is …

Sensors Free Full-Text An Indoor Fingerprint Positioning …

WebKNN Algorithm. The various steps involved in KNN are as follows:- → Choose the value of ‘K’ where ‘K’ refers to the number of nearest neighbors of the new data point to be … WebApr 26, 2024 · The principle behind nearest neighbor methods is to find a predefined number of training samples closest in distance to the new point, and predict the label from these. The number of samples can be a user-defined constant (k-nearest neighbor learning), or vary based on the local density of points (radius-based neighbor learning). ems creditcard https://scruplesandlooks.com

k-nearest neighbor classification - MATLAB - MathWorks

WebAug 21, 2007 · In this paper, we propose a kernel difference-weighted k-nearest neighbor (KDF-KNN) method for pattern classification. The proposed method defines the weighted KNN rule as a constrained ... WebNov 24, 2024 · In this case, the KNN algorithm would collect the values associated with the k closest examples from the one you want to make a prediction on and aggregate them … WebTrain k -Nearest Neighbor Classifier. Train a k -nearest neighbor classifier for Fisher's iris data, where k, the number of nearest neighbors in the predictors, is 5. Load Fisher's iris data. load fisheriris X = meas; Y = species; X is a numeric matrix that contains four petal measurements for 150 irises. drayton two port motorised valve

A Weighted KNN Algorithm Based on Entropy Method

Category:KNN Algorithm What is KNN Algorithm How does KNN Function

Tags:Difference between knn and weighted knn

Difference between knn and weighted knn

KNN Vs. K-Means - Coding Ninjas

WebMay 2, 2024 · In kknn: Weighted k-Nearest Neighbors. Description Usage Arguments Details Value Author(s) References See Also Examples. Description. Performs k … WebSimilarly in KNN, model parameters actually grows with the training data set - you can imagine each training case as a "parameter" in the model. KNN vs. K-mean Many people get confused between these two statistical techniques- K-mean and K-nearest neighbor. See some of the difference below -

Difference between knn and weighted knn

Did you know?

WebFeb 8, 2024 · The changes between background colors indicate the Bayes decision boundary. It is linear, but the pixels make it appear jagged. We will want the K-NN models to approximate this as close as possible. I trained … WebI am reading notes on using weights for KNN and I came across an example that I don't really understand. Suppose we have K = 7 and we obtain the following: Decision set = …

Web- Few hyperparameters: KNN only requires a k value and a distance metric, which is low when compared to other machine learning algorithms. Disadvantages - Does not scale … WebThere are 4 votes from class A and 3 votes from class B. We give class A a score of 4 0.95 ≈ 4.21 and class B a score of 3 0.05 = 60. Class B has a higher score, hence we assign it to class B. This makes much more sense now, the percentage 95% and 5% is the class frequency, I thought it was the weights.

WebSep 4, 2024 · A KNN algorithm based on attribute weighted entropy is proposed in reference [ 15 ], the method of normalized entropy value is used to calculate the weight of characteristic attributes, and the factor of attribute weight is added to calculate the distance between samples. To sum up, most of the KNN optimization algorithms which join … WebJun 14, 2024 · To overcome this disadvantage, weighted kNN is used. In weighted kNN, the nearest k points are given a weight using a …

Webtest some weighting variants in K-nearest neighbor classification. The HEOM distance metric and three values of K (1, 4 and 5) were used in K-nearest neighbor classification. Twelve datasets were selected from the UCI Machine Learning Repository for the analysis. Chi-square attribute weighting was done in order to implement the two

WebApr 13, 2024 · The weighted KNN (WKNN) algorithm can effectively improve the classification performance of the KNN algorithm by assigning different weights to the K nearest neighbors of the test sample according to the different distances between the two, where the maximum weight is assigned to the nearest neighbor closest to the test sample. ems credits freeWebAug 21, 2024 · When performing regression, the task is to find the value of a new data point, based on the average weighted sum of the 3 nearest points. KNN with K = 3, when used for regression: The KNN algorithm will start by calculating the distance of the new point from all the points. It then finds the 3 points with the least distance to the new point. drayton tyres draytonWebApr 13, 2024 · The weighted KNN (WKNN) algorithm can effectively improve the classification performance of the KNN algorithm by assigning different weights to the K … drayton two wire thermostat